- Elon Musk took to X to accuse Apple of manipulating the App Store rankings to keep any A.I. brand other than OpenAI out of the top spot. Sam Altman jumped into the fray, posting that Musk has manipulated the X algorithm to prioritize his tweets, and journalists were quick to point out that the Chinese A.I. firm Deep Seek briefly held the No. 1 spot in the App Store, as did Grok, Musk's own A.I. app, this past spring.
